What Exactly Are Single Hung Impact Windows?

Single hung impact windows belong to a category of impact-rated window in which only the lower sash opens and closes, while the upper sash does not move. This design differs from double hung windows, in which both panels are operable. The fixed upper sash produces a tighter seal against wind-driven rain.

The "impact" designation relates to the specially engineered glass incorporated into every unit. Every panel features dual glass sheets bonded with a tough interlayer material, often PVB or SGP interlayer. Even when the glass breaks during impact, the interlayer holds the fragments in place, maintaining the integrity of the window frame.

The framing used in single hung impact windows come in materials like aluminum alloy or composite materials, each designed to handle the structural stress created during a major storm. Why Homeowners Choose Single Hung Impact Windows

  • Hurricane and Storm Protection: Single hung impact windows are rated to resist pressures over 140 mph, which makes them the strongest safety investments available to homeowners.
  • Improved Thermal Performance: Dual-pane construction and weatherstripping minimize thermal exchange, reducing the effort your AC system needs to maintain comfortable temperatures.
  • Quieter Indoor Environment: The thick laminated glass absorbs and blocks ambient noise from traffic, neighbors, and surrounding noise sources, creating a much calmer home environment.
  • UV Ray Blocking: Single hung impact windows reduce harmful levels of ultraviolet radiation, slowing the deterioration of upholstery and hardwood floors from sun damage.
  • Improved Burglary Resistance: The structural integrity that withstands flying objects also makes forced entry more difficult for burglars to breach.
  • Potential Insurance Savings: Most homeowners insurers in the state provide significant premium reductions for properties equipped with impact-rated products, which can offset the initial investment over time.
  • Low Maintenance Design: With no upper sash to clean, single hung impact windows require less routine upkeep relative to more complex window styles, ensuring they remain a hassle-free long-term choice.

The Single Hung Impact Windows Project Step by Step

  1. Initial Consultation and Measurement — A certified technician from our office visits your home to measure every opening and understand your priorities. Precise measurements are critical because single hung impact windows must fit perfectly to meet Florida Building Code standards.
  2. Window Manufacturing and Style Choice — After confirming sizing and design choices, your windows go into production to fit your property's precise measurements. You choose from aluminum or vinyl frames, glass options and any additional features including obscure or tinted glazing.
  3. Permitting and Code Compliance — We manages the complete permit applications through the appropriate municipal channels. Every installation must be reviewed by a building official to confirm adherence to the Florida Building Code.
  4. Existing Window Demo and Frame Prep — At the start of the project, the existing windows are carefully taken out while protecting adjacent wall surfaces and finishes. Every rough opening is measured, squared, and made ready for the new single hung impact windows.
  5. Secure Placement and Frame Anchoring — The custom-fabricated windows is positioned in the rough frame and secured using rust-proof fasteners according to the Florida Product Approval method. Secure installation confirms the window performs as rated.
  6. Perimeter Sealing and Water Infiltration Control — After anchoring, the perimeter is sealed with high-quality impact-rated sealants to stop moisture from entering through the rough opening. Proper sealing matters just as much as the window itself in preventing future water damage.
  7. Quality Check and Project Completion — The closing inspection confirms every single hung impact window functions and secures as intended. Our team cleans up waste and protective coverings and walks you through the proper care of your new single hung impact windows.

Single Hung Impact Windows Common Questions Answered

How long does a single hung impact windows installation take from start to finish?

Most residential installations involving a full house with impact-rated units takes between two and five days based on how many of windows, accessibility, and inspection scheduling. Smaller projects — like swapping out several openings on one floor — may wrap up within just a few hours.

What will impact-rated windows typically cost in Boca Raton?

Total investment ranges based on opening dimensions, frame type and the complexity of the installation. As a general guideline, single hung impact windows can range from $400 to $900 per window, fully installed. How long can single hung impact windows hold up in Florida's coastal environment?

Properly installed units set by a qualified installer commonly perform well for 30 or more years even in high-humidity, salt-air environments. The type of frame affects longevity — vinyl is highly resistant to corrosion in coastal zones. Simple annual maintenance adds years to the product's performance.

Can these windows satisfy today's Florida Building Code requirements?

Every impact-rated product we install carry a valid state-issued Product Approval, verifying they've cleared high-velocity hurricane zone testing and wind-load tests required by the Florida Building Code.
